Scenic ranch-style resort with golf and outdoor adventures

The Millennium Resort Scottsdale McCormick Ranch offers nature buffs and golf fanatics a picturesque, intimate setting in a location accessible to metro business areas and attractions. As Scottsdale's only lakeside boutique resort, the ranch cultivates relaxation and outdoor adventure just three miles from Old Town Scottsdale with breathtaking mountain views on all sides. Golf facilities include two 18-hole PGA golf courses. A new 20-foot horizontal waterfall splashes softly into the pool while guests head to the pool bar for refreshments.

Rooms
Outfitted in sunny yellows and Southwestern style, the 125 oversized guest rooms of Millennium Resort Scottsdale McCormick Ranch put guests in vacation mode. Don a luxurious robes and head to the balcony or patio for spectacular views of the Camelback or McDowell mountains or a scenic lake and golf course vista. After relaxing in front of the 40-inch flat-panel screen TVs with cable, pay-per-view movies and games, sleep in an upgraded Dynasty Bedding package with Frette linens. Complimentary wireless and high-speed Internet access, a refrigerator, and a room-service menu from on-site Pinon Grill round out the ranch amenities. Families and those on an extended stay might consider a two- or three-bedroom villa.
Features
Award-winning Pinon Grill serves breakfast, lunch and authentic Southwest-style cuisine for dinner. Diamondbacks Bar and Grill creates cocktails to go with its casual dining menu. Dine poolside at the Coyote Cabana Bar. Overlooking Camelback Lake and the Majestic McDowell Mountains, Millennium Resort Scottsdale McCormick Ranch boasts two PGA golf courses with a clubhouse, a lighted tennis and sand volleyball court, fishing, paddle boating and canoeing. All this recreation lies just 20 minutes from Sky Harbor International Airport and five minutes from Scottsdale City Center.

Area description
Millennium Resort, Scottsdale, McCormick Ranch is located just 20 minutes from Sky Harbor International Airport and five minutes from Scottsdale City Center. Overlooking Camelback Lake and the Majestic McDowell Mountains, the Millennium offers two PGA golf courses with clubhouse, spa services, one lighted tennis and sand volleyball court, fishing, sailboats, paddleboats and canoes for your leisure fun. The resort’s Southwestern hospitality and recreational wealth is ideal for pleasure and business travelers alike.

Dining

Pinon Grill
From fire-roasted chillies to sumptuous sweets, the resort captures the spirit of the Southwest flair with a subtle twist of the Sonora lifestyle. Relax and enjoy enchanting views of Camelback Lake and the McDowell Mountains while dining indoors at the Pinon Grill, or outdoors on our lakeside terrace. The restaurant is open at 6:30 a.m. each day for breakfast; lunch is served daily from 11:00 a.m. - 4:00 p.m. Our award-winning contemporary Southwestern cuisine is featured at dinner between the hours of 5:00 p.m. and 10:00 p.m
